The Hutchinson Community College Men's Basketball team start the season ranked No. 13 in the 2022-23 NJCAA Division I Preseason rankings.
The Blue Dragons were one of four Jayhawk Conference teams to be ranked to begin the season. Coffeyville was tabbed 14th, Seward County is 16th and Butler came in at 23rd. Dodge City, Cowley and Garden City are all receiving votes.
Last season, the Blue Dragons began the 2021-2022 receiving votes, which broke a 10-year run of being ranked in the preseason poll.
As head coach Tommy DeSalme begins his second year at Hutchinson, the Blue Dragons were also the favorite to win the Jayhawk Conference.
The 2022-23 Blue Dragons return four players from a 26-9 team that was a Jayhawk Conference and Region VI runner-up and made it to the second round of the NJCAA Tournament.
Last year's national champion, Northwest Florida State, was tapped No. 1 in the poll following a 2022 national title game victory win over Salt Lake, who is ranked fifth. Northwest Florida State received 12 first-place votes. Second-ranked Florida Southwestern State earned one first-place vote. Indian Hills is ranked third.
The Blue Dragons open their 2022-2023 campaign at 7:30 p.m. on Tuesday, Nov. 1 against Fort Scott at the Sports Arena.
